Amidst the admittedly many missteps that plagued the PT, there are several saving graces as well: first and foremost is the fact that much of the focus is on my favorite Jedi, Obi-Wan (and Ewan McGregor is absolutely awesome in the role; REALLY looking forward to his tv series coming up on Disney +).  Next is the bad@$$ that we were introduced to in TPM: Darth Maul.  He could've remained a one-note character but I think that TCW (and later, Rebels) fleshed him out for the better (and Sam Witwer is fantastic, not only giving him a haunting, hunted voice but also expanding on a compelling villain).  Again, admittedly the fight between Maul, Obi-Wan, and Qui-gon brought me back to my childhood with a fantastic duel.  Speaking of which...

Still think it was William's best score outside of ANH
I couldn't agree more; "Dual of the Fates" is still one of my favorite "epic song" pieces that I love to listen to.

There are many critiques that I have with TPM but it gave us all some fantastic elements that contributed to the overall SW universe that I'm proud to say that I am still a fan of  :)
